TaskUs (TASK) shares climbed 2.64% to $6.21 in recent trading, continuing a bounce from the key support zone near $5.90. The price action suggests buyers are stepping in at that level, though the stock remains below the near-term resistance at $6.52. Volume patterns and sector positioning provide additional context for this move.
